How to Wander Wisely in Hood River with Your Pet
- Enjoy the fresh air at Panorama Point County Park, Vinzenz Lausmann Memorial State Natural Area, and Lost Lake.
- Other things to see include Hood River Marina, Indian Creek Golf Course, and Western Antique Aeroplane & Automobile Museum.
- Need a pet store? Try Gorge Dog, Mac Koi Water Gardens, or Mt Hood Danes.
- For vet care, Alpine Veterinary Hospital, Columbia Gorge Veterinary Clinic Inc., and Tucker Road Animal Hospital are located in the area.

Pet-Friendly Times to Vacation in Hood River
Weather can make or break your stay, especially if you're hoping to spend time outdoors. We have gathered the average day and night temperatures to help plan your time in Hood River.
From January to March, average temperatures range from 62°F in the daytime to 28°F at night. Between April and June, the daytime average is 84°F and the nighttime average is 37°F.
From July to September, average temperatures range from 91°F in the daytime to 44°F at night. Between October and December, the daytime average is 76°F and the nighttime average is 28°F.
